51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 3054|回复: 8
打印 上一主题 下一主题

[Robot] robot里面有乱码,怎么解决?help

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2006-1-12 21:04:06 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我在robot的函数中设了断点,但是程序运行到断点的位置不停.是不是因为有乱码?
但是我找了整个文件也没有发现乱码.
如果是有乱码,怎么解决?
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

该用户从未签到

2#
发表于 2006-1-12 21:19:20 | 只看该作者
乱码?
脚本里有乱码?
到底有没有乱码,哪里有?
回复 支持 反对

使用道具 举报

该用户从未签到

3#
发表于 2006-1-13 08:28:46 | 只看该作者
不懂楼主的意思,没有发现怎么说有呢
回复 支持 反对

使用道具 举报

该用户从未签到

4#
 楼主| 发表于 2006-1-13 21:28:00 | 只看该作者
他们说因为有中文,所以就出现乱码.
把乱码去掉后,因为整个文件被编译了,所以在乱码之后的内容也就全乱了.然后程序就不能停在断点的地方了

他们说解决的办法是把乱码之后的内容全部重写.
有没有其他办法解决?
回复 支持 反对

使用道具 举报

  • TA的每日心情
    无聊
    2015-6-14 21:08
  • 签到天数: 1 天

    连续签到: 1 天

    [LV.1]测试小兵

    5#
    发表于 2006-1-14 10:42:43 | 只看该作者

    国外软件对中文敏感

    使用Administrator新建项目、配置项目、使用Robot新建脚本等等,这些操作中最好使用英文命名,哪怕是汉语拼音也好。
    国外的很多软件对中文路径敏感,比如Oracle的安装还有LoadRunner的安装。这些软件在安装时就对中文感冒,何况应用时了。所以建议楼主所有跟路径、命名有关的都用英文或汉语拼音,你可以在描述信息里输入中文注释。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    6#
     楼主| 发表于 2006-1-15 19:20:46 | 只看该作者
    我就是在写的基本函数中有中文注释.
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    7#
    发表于 2006-1-16 08:00:16 | 只看该作者
    注释是不会影响你的脚本运行的
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    8#
     楼主| 发表于 2006-1-16 23:54:44 | 只看该作者
    但是它就不能停在我设断点地方.
    而且要出现下面情况
    比如:
    if a <>0 then
      exit function
    end if
    但是跟踪变量a,它的值明明就是0,可是还是要进如到if里面.
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    9#
    发表于 2006-1-17 14:34:17 | 只看该作者
    两种情况引起乱码:
    一是脚本的行数太大,一般超过500行以后就有出现乱码的可能性。
    二是脚本里大量使用了中文。


    解决方法:
    要每日备份脚本,因为一旦产生乱码,会把脚本的后半部门全部截掉,需要从最近的备份中恢复。
    回复 支持 反对

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/1 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2024-11-14 12:31 , Processed in 0.071832 second(s), 25 queries .

    Powered by Discuz! X3.2

    © 2001-2024 Comsenz Inc.

    快速回复 返回顶部 返回列表